Shootout will be returning to Mosport International Raceway in Bowmanville, Ontario. The event comprises of a full day of autocrossing from 9:00am to 5:00pm. Entrants must be Formula SAE/ Formula Student racecars that have passed technical inspection at a sanctioned FSAE competition. All cars will be inspected for safety before being admitted to the pitlane, according to the FSAE technical inspection form.
Registration is NOW OPEN
Where: Mosport International Kart Track
When: Saturday, September 18th, 2010 from 9: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.

Over $3000 worth of prestigious awards, gifts and cash prizes are waiting to be won in both the team categories and individual performance categories. The grand prize is a set of Goodyear tires.
The Kart Track at Mosport offers a technical challenge with tight and wide corners, slalom and most interestingly, elevation changes. This is a chance for your team to truly see how you car performs against the clock. All laps are one-by-one time trials, run as an autocross event.

Overall Results:
Drivers:
1.Kevin Ferah ETS 1:07.926
2.Taylor Hattori RIT 1:07.995
3.Alekseyu Kovtun RIT 1:08.440
4.David Hnatio UM -Dearborn 1:08.625
5.Benoit Vaillancourt ETS 1:09.349
Constructors:
1.ETS 1:09.12
2.RIT 1:10.97
3.Missouri S&T 1:12.18
4.UM-Dearborn 1:13.34
5.UToledo 1:13.89
After sorting out some marshalling issues in the morning we were able to pump out over 300 solid laps. We will post up the full official results this week and pics will trickle in shortly. Hope you guys had a good time.
